How to Teach Computer Science

How to Teach Computer Science
Author: Alan J. Harrison
Publisher:
Total Pages: 242
Release: 2021
Genre: Computer science
ISBN: 9781914351341


Download How to Teach Computer Science Book in PDF, Epub and Kindle

Novice teachers and those wishing to improve their practice will find in this book valuable conceptual insights that illuminate the subject, and research-informed pedagogy that really works. Organised around the English GCSE specification, this is essential reading for the Computer Science teacher.


How to Teach Computer Science
Language: en
Pages: 242
Authors: Alan J. Harrison
Categories: Computer science
Type: BOOK - Published: 2021 - Publisher:

GET EBOOK

Novice teachers and those wishing to improve their practice will find in this book valuable conceptual insights that illuminate the subject, and research-inform
How to Teach Computer Science
Language: en
Pages:
Authors: Alan J Harrison
Categories:
Type: BOOK - Published: 2021-06-28 - Publisher: John Catt Educational

GET EBOOK

Novice teachers and those wishing to improve their practice will find in this book valuable conceptual insights that illuminate the subject, and research-inform
How to Teach Computer Science: Parable, practice and pedagogy
Language: en
Pages: 292
Authors: Alan J. Harrison
Categories: Education
Type: BOOK - Published: 2021-07-16 - Publisher: John Catt

GET EBOOK

This book is for new or aspiring computer science teachers wishing to improve their subject knowledge and gain confidence in the classroom. And it's for experie
Teaching Computing in Secondary Schools
Language: en
Pages: 243
Authors: William Lau
Categories: Education
Type: BOOK - Published: 2017-09-22 - Publisher: Routledge

GET EBOOK

This book provides a step-by-step guide to teaching computing at secondary level. It offers an entire framework for planning and delivering the curriculum and s
Computer Science in K-12
Language: en
Pages:
Authors: Shuchi Grover
Categories:
Type: BOOK - Published: 2020-05 - Publisher:

GET EBOOK

Coding teaches our students the essence of logical thinking and problem solving while also preparing them for a world in which computing is becoming increasingl